Residential Energy Services is an experienced consulting and analysis firm providing an unbiased approach to improving your home’s energy consumption. After a scheduled home energy test we provide the home owner with a Home Energy Evaluation Report of prioritized energy saving recommendations. The homeowner can then decide which improvements they can make themselves and which may need to be addressed professionally through a third-party contractor. Residential Energy Services is pleased to announce that it has been
recognized by the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) with a 2011 ENERGY
STAR Leadership in Housing Award. This award recognizes the important contribution
RES has made to energy-efficient construction and environmental
protection by verifying more than 242 ENERGY STAR qualified homes last
year. Collectively, these homes will save our customers approximately $108,174 on utility bills each year.
